sh-coff build error with gcc-3.5-20040801


Hi,
I have taken following source code snapshots to build SH(COFF) toolchain,
1. GCC(gcc-3.5-20040801).
2. binutils(binutils-040802).
3. newlib-1.12.0 (Dated 15/07/2004 from CVS).
Host:i686-pc-linux-gnu
I am able to build tool chain for ELF format.
I am already adding the new cross-binutils to my path after I built and installed them.
While building toolchain for targets SH(COFF), I am getting error as mentioned below at the stage of final cross gcc building. Kindly suggest how to remove this error.
